Hi to everybody,
I've installed latest version of Ganymede RCP/Plugin from eclipse web site
but I've a probrem trying to creare a plugin with an extension: In
"Extensions" tab of MANIFEST editor window I added the
org.eclipse.cdt.core.BinaryParser extension point but if I try to right
click on added item to add my extension, a popup containing only "Generic"
entry is shown. I've tryed with others extension points with the same
result. Can somebody tell me where is my mistake? Isn't it the right way
to create a plugin that extends eclipse components ?

I haven't worked with CDT, but tried this extension point and got the same result as you are getting.
However, on searching for usage of this ext pt., I found this in one plugin.xml
<extension
id="MachO"
name="%MachOParser.name"
point="org.eclipse.cdt.core.BinaryParser">
<cextension>
<run
class="org.eclipse.cdt.utils.macho.parser.MachOParser">
</run>
</cextension>
</extension>
May be you can extend it in similar fashion.
